Japanese women used to bind their feet from childhood, to keep them small. Small feet were considered a desirable asset.

Masai women essentially bind their necks, by wearing multiple tight-fitting golden bands. Long necks are considered a desirable trait.

There used to be some people -- forget who -- who bound the heads of their infants to give them elongated skulls. I forget why.

I was just thinking about this in relation to evangelical families. They bind their children's brains with strict teachings, outside of which they're not allowed to roam. This results in misshapen brains as surely as bound feet or necks.

I admit to an unfair advantage. Many years ago, I knew a Chinese woman whose feet were bound. A Chinese man named Hem Gin needed a new wife after his first died. He had kids and a restaurant to run. His family in China picked one for him and shipped her over here. She was probably around fifty years old at the time and her feet were bound. It never seemed to slow her down, though. She quickly acquired the sobriquet , "Dragon Lady." She was not one you wanted to be angry with you.
